MATLAB图像裂缝识别算法研究及操作指南

版权申诉
0 下载量 109 浏览量 更新于2024-11-13 收藏 104KB ZIP 举报
资源摘要信息:"基于MATLAB实现的图像的道路裂缝识别算法的研究+使用说明文档.zip"是一个关于图像处理和识别技术的实用资源,主要聚焦于道路裂缝检测的问题。该资源基于MATLAB软件平台,提供了一套完整的道路裂缝识别算法,以及详细的使用说明文档。 ### 知识点详细说明: 1. **MATLAB平台:** - MATLAB是一种高性能的数值计算环境和编程语言,广泛应用于工程计算、数据分析、算法开发等领域。 - 它提供了一个集成的开发环境,包括交互式命令窗口、脚本编辑器、图形用户界面和丰富的工具箱,特别适合进行矩阵运算、算法开发和数据可视化。 2. **图像识别技术:** - 图像识别技术是计算机视觉领域的一个重要分支,旨在让计算机能够处理图像和视频信息,理解其内容并进行识别。 - 道路裂缝识别是一个具体的图像识别应用场景,它可以帮助维护道路安全,及时发现破损,减少事故。 3. **道路裂缝检测算法:** - 道路裂缝识别算法通常包括图像预处理、特征提取、裂缝检测和裂缝分割等步骤。 - 算法可能基于图像处理技术(如边缘检测、形态学操作)或深度学习模型(如卷积神经网络CNN)来实现裂缝的自动识别。 4. **使用说明文档:** - 使用说明文档通常提供详细的操作步骤,帮助用户理解和运行代码。 - 在本资源中,文档将指导用户如何将代码文件导入MATLAB工作环境,如何运行主函数以及如何解读结果。 5. **代码运行环境和版本:** - MATLAB 2020b是本算法运行的指定环境,它提供了最新的工具箱和改进的性能,适用于复杂的算法实现和大数据处理。 - 如果用户遇到运行问题,文档提供了故障排查的提示,并建议根据MATLAB的错误提示进行调整。 6. **仿真与咨询服务:** - 资源提供者还提供了额外的服务,包括期刊文献复现、程序定制以及科研合作等。 - 这些服务可能涉及更高级的图像处理技术,如功率谱估计、故障诊断分析、雷达通信技术、滤波估计、目标定位、生物电信号处理和通信系统分析等。 7. **通信系统分析:** - 文档中提及的通信系统分析涉及多种技术,例如DOA估计、编码译码、变分模态分解、数字信号处理等,这些技术在道路裂缝识别算法中可能用于提高识别精度或改进算法性能。 8. **数字信号处理和传输:** - 为了提高道路裂缝识别的准确性,可能需要对获取的图像信号进行一系列的处理,如去噪、分析和调制。 - 这些处理步骤旨在优化信号质量,提升裂缝检测的效果。 9. **误码率、信号检测与识别融合:** - 算法可能需要评估信号传输过程中的误码率,以确保裂缝识别的准确性不受干扰。 - 信号检测和识别融合则可能涉及到将不同类型的传感器数据结合起来,以获得更全面的裂缝检测结果。 10. **LEACH协议与水声通信:** - LEACH协议是低功耗自适应集簇分层路由协议,常用于无线传感器网络中,可能在道路裂缝监测系统中发挥作用。 - 水声通信则是利用声波在水下进行通信的技术,虽然与道路裂缝识别技术不直接相关,但在智能交通系统中可能有潜在的应用价值。 ### 总结: 这个资源为用户提供了基于MATLAB的道路裂缝识别算法及其实现的详细指导,覆盖了从基础的图像处理到高级的信号处理和通信技术的多个方面。用户不仅能够通过这个资源学习和使用现成的道路裂缝检测算法,还能了解到一系列与通信、信号处理相关的先进技术。这对于工程技术人员和研究人员来说,不仅是一个实用的工具,也是一个很好的学习平台。